Description

Statement from the artist: This view is of the village center covered by a bank of thick fog. It came from the deck of a house on the south side of Stinson Mountain. It had to be made when conditions were just right. I got a one ring alert/call one morning at dawn to come up. Technically, making the plate, responding to the texture of fog was quite a task. It was made by employing a series of layered aquatints to achieve a soft graduated tone on the copper plate.
